The World Health Organization’s declaration on March 11, 2020, that the novel coronavirus (COVID-19) is now a pandemic and has marked a significant shift in the response from communities across Canada and at all levels of government.

In response to this evolving health risk, the Office of Controlled Substances has issued a short-term subsection 56(1) exemption from the Controlled Drugs and Substances Act in the public interest. This exemption authorizes pharmacists to prescribe, sell, or provide controlled substances in limited circumstances, or transfer prescriptions for controlled substances.
